MZANSI’S NO.1 COOKING SHOW COLOUR YOUR PLATE WITH KOORETURNS FOR A FIERY FOURTH SEASON
JOHANNESBURG – After 3 successfully sizzling seasons Colour Your Plate with KOO returns to South Africa’s screens for a much anticipated fourth season. Dubbed as South Africa’s favourite cooking show where the stakes are higher, the flavours are bold, and the kitchen is sizzling with excitement. The new season premiered on Tuesday 11 February at 7pm on SABC2 as the hunt for South Africa’s next culinary superstar continues.

Lovers of the show are set to expect a riveting season as the kitchen heats up every week with exciting challenges that are set to challenge the contestant’s culinary prowess. Back on the judging panel are Head Judge – the internationally acclaimed Chef Rueben Riffle and nutritionist Arthur Ramoroka who will be championing KOO’s balanced eating ethos – 5 a day (3 veggies and 2 fruit) for a balanced diet.

What makes this season even more special is its diverse representation. The show celebrates inclusivity across various walks of life, highlighting contestants from different provinces and backgrounds. From home cooks and small business owners to trained chefs and online cooking enthusiasts, the competition showcases the rich, varied talent South Africa has to offer.
Season four of Colour Your Plate with KOO will see contestants flex their culinary musclesas they tackle weekly challenges every Tuesday at 7pm on SABC2 from the 11th of Februaryas they battle it out in the kitchen for the grand prize of R150 000,00.
